The Strategic Evolution of Electric Vehicle Infrastructure in Tanzania

Tanzania's transport landscape is undergoing a monumental paradigm shift. Propelled by the National Environmental Management Council (NEMC) and progressive private sector initiatives, the transition to e-mobility is moving from concept to high-volume commercial implementation. Key growth centers like Dar es Salaam, Arusha, Dodoma, and Zanzibar are actively introducing electric transit buses, commercial delivery vans, and specialized electric safari cruisers.

However, the rapid adoption of electric vehicles is heavily constrained by central grid dependencies. Decentralized and microgrid solutions, combined with highly resilient portable EV chargers, present a scalable answer. Unlike fixed public charging columns, which require intensive permitting, capital expenditures, and sub-station upgrades, portable AC and DC solutions provide modular, instantaneous charging capability for B2B fleet hubs and remote tourist destinations.

Engineering Portable EVSE for Tanzania’s Unique Grid & Climatic Dynamics

Importing standardized commercial chargers from conventional catalogs without localized adjustments routinely leads to field failures. The Tanzanian operating envelope has specific structural challenges that demand localized mechanical and electrical engineering:

  • Advanced Over-Voltage & Surge Suppression Tanzania’s national grid, overseen by TANESCO, occasionally experiences voltage variations (ranging from 180V up to 260V) and lightning-induced surges. Our portable units feature integrated smart MCU monitoring that isolates power within 15 milliseconds of sensing standard-deviation anomalies, self-recovering only when the grid stabilizes.
  • Thermal Dissipation Under Intense Heat Ambient temperatures in areas like Coastal Dar es Salaam and Central Dodoma frequently spike. Standard plastic-housed chargers suffer thermal degradation. We employ high-thermal-conductivity structural PC-ABS composites coupled with intelligent thermal throttling, allowing full-load operation up to 55°C without compromising component lifespan.
  • IP67 Dust and Monsoon-Moisture Protection During the Masika rainy season, off-road conditions and urban charging hubs face extreme humidity and rainfall. Our IP67 double-cavity enclosure prevents microscopic red-clay dust and pressurized rainwater from reaching delicate internal high-frequency current sensors.

1. How do your portable EV chargers handle the voltage instability common in Tanzania’s power grid?

Our portable charging units are engineered with a dynamic protection architecture. Standard home chargers easily fail when voltage fluctuates away from the standard 230V rating. Our chargers feature integrated Microcontroller Units (MCUs) that constantly monitor the incoming grid frequency and voltage. If voltage drops below 170V or rises above 265V, the unit automatically scales back current draw or pauses charging, displaying a diagnostic warning code. Once the grid parameters return to safe operating levels, the charger automatically resumes charging, protecting both the vehicle’s battery management system (BMS) and the charger’s internal components.

2. Can your portable EV chargers be powered directly by off-grid solar micro-grids at safari lodges?

Yes. This is a key design feature of our 7kW, 11kW, and 22kW models. Our portable chargers allow the user to manually adjust the current output in precise increments (e.g., 8A, 10A, 13A, 16A, 32A). When connected to a solar hybrid inverter or battery storage bank in remote safari camps (such as Serengeti or Ngorongoro), operators can match the charger's power draw to the real-time output of the PV array or the remaining capacity of the battery bank, avoiding overloading the local mini-grid.

4. Why are silver-plated copper pins essential for portable charging cables in coastal climates like Dar es Salaam?

Coastal environments have high salinity, humidity, and temperatures, which accelerate the oxidation of standard brass electrical pins. This oxidation increases resistance, leading to energy loss, dangerous overheating at the vehicle inlet, and connector failure. We construct our charging guns with heavy silver plating (minimum thickness of 5 microns) over highly conductive, oxygen-free copper wires. This provides exceptionally low contact resistance, limits temperature spikes during high-current charging sessions, and ensures reliable performance over more than 10,000 insertion cycles.
